Troubleshooting

Symptom

Probable cause

Remedy

No picture shown in the screen.

Gearshift lever is not in the “R”
position.

More the gearshift lever to the “R” position.

Camera image fuzzy or blurred.

Camera lens is dirty or wet.

Clean the lens with a moist soft cloth. Avoid harsh
cleaners or shop towels.

The colors in the rear camera are
not “true to life.”

The camera is sensitive to infrared
light, which alters the true colors.

This is normal.

There is a bright spot or bright
vertical line on the displayed
image.

Typically, this is caused either by a
reflection of sunlight from a shiny
part of your vehicle or by a bright
light source, such as the sun or
another vehicle’s high beams.

This is normal (see page 6).

The displayed image is too bright
or too dark.

Camera brightness needs
adjustment.

Adjust the brightness using the navigation system’s
“Zoom In”, and “Zoom Out” controls. See the
Navigation System Manual for details.

Verify that the camera lens is not covered.

No picture shown in the screen.

Camera lens may be blocked or
covered.

No picture shown in the screen.

Camera harness damaged or rear
camera display is function in the
display unit is inoperative.

See your dealer for assistance.
